Ensuring Safety with High-Performance Brake Pads

The brake pad kit is an essential component of your vehicle's braking system, providing the necessary friction to slow down and stop your car safely. This critical part is needed to ensure efficient braking performance, especially during sudden stops or in emergency situations. Its function is to apply pressure and create friction against the brake rotor, converting kinetic energy into thermal energy, thus slowing the wheels.

How Does it Work

When you press the brake pedal, hydraulic fluid is pushed from the master cylinder to the calipers at each wheel. The calipers then press the brake pads against the spinning brake disc. The friction generated from this contact converts motion into heat, which effectively reduces the speed of the vehicle and ultimately brings it to a halt.

Consequences of a Faulty Brake Pad

If this part becomes worn or damaged, the braking efficiency will be significantly compromised. You may experience longer stopping distances, a potential grinding noise, or even damage to the brake rotors if metal parts come into contact. This can lead to unsafe driving conditions, increased repair costs, and in severe cases, brake failure, which poses a serious safety risk.
